Output 3d6f12162b287f21b7d18f6475cde33931bb24c5c7457aa3270547eddade171f:0
- value
- 2850380
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 589df98ff416333cce76bf6b9e17ed914fef560d OP_EQUAL
- address
- 39madi8oCcZkH7ETf9EpQLQEe1yqzoCWJY
- transaction
- 3d6f12162b287f21b7d18f6475cde33931bb24c5c7457aa3270547eddade171f
- confirmations
- 428970
- spent
- true